I just removed a connection for Sarah Warren and suggested a merge with a profile in a Sarah Warren in a different family based on the death date and location. (The family you attached her to was in Watertown, not Boston or Hingham).
Looking at some of the profiles you're creating through your gedcom, I'm not seeing reliable sources as required for pre-1700 profiles. And for example, I see that you created a profile for Nathaniel Warren (1670-1723) and attached him to parents. But the father's profile which is sourced, doesn't mention a son Nathaniel. I took a quick look at his father's will and didn't see a Nathaniel there either.
Gedcom imports seem convenient, but they don't work really well with the requirement to communicate first and provide reliable sources for pre-1700 profiles. You might want to consider working directly with adding/improving existing profiles manually so you can communicate with profile managers and add your sources as you go.
You have created what appear to be numerous pre-1700 profiles in the Warren family, none of which I saw reliable sources on. Please make sure you add reliable sources in line with the Pre-1700 Certification requirements. Also, you should verify that the profiles you want to add do not already have WT profiles before you add them. You should expect to see several merge requests in your email; please approve them promptly. If you have any questions, please reply.
S Willson, PGM Project Co-Leader
